Tier5 Theatre Company presents...
MUCH ADO ABOUT NOTHING
by William Shakespeare
“Thou and I are too wise to woo peaceably.”
Directed by James Cougar Canfield and Kate Rankine
Thursday, August 14th through Sunday, August 24th, 2025
Thursdays, Fridays, Saturdays at 7pm,
Sundays at 2pm
plus additional performances
Sunday, August 17th at 7pm and Thursday, August 21st at 2pm
Benedick and Beatrice have history. Big, messy, will-they-won’t-they, love/hate history. The best kind, am I right? And everyone knows it. So when Benedick, along with the regiment of soldiers he belongs to returns to Leonato’s four star resort in Messina, where Beatrice happens to be living, things are about to get fun. Oh, there’s also Claudio and Hero, who totally have the hots for each other but aren’t ever going to make a move- without a little help. And then there’s Don John, he’s gorg but likes to cause a little (well, a lot) of trouble. And all taking place at a beautiful beachside resort? It’s giving White Lotus- we just hope everyone makes it out alive.
After the smashing success of last summer’s A MIDSUMMER NIGHT’S DREAM, Tier5 is ecstatic to bring another of Shakespeare’s iconic comedies to life and put their signature twist on this classic about rumors, gossip, falling in love, and falling out of it.
So grab your suntan lotion, a big floppy hat, and join us at the beach (or El Barrio) for another summer of Shakespeare like you’ve never seen it before!
